For this card, I started with Basic White Thick Cardstock, embossed it with the Exposed Brick 3D Embossing Folder, and adhered it to a Basic White Thick Cardstock base. Next, I used a Blending Brush to add Lemon Lime Twist, Granny Apple Green, and Azure Afternoon to Basic White Thick Cardstock, and used a Water Painter to splatter water droplets. After I dried the cardstock with a Heat Tool, I used a Water Painter, along with White Craft Ink, to add some splatters. After I dried the cardstock with a Heat Tool once more, I layered a slightly large piece of Basic White Thick Cardstock underneath, and used Stampin’ Dimensionals to the panel to the card base.

To create the leaves and flowers, I used Blending Brushes, along with Lemon Lime Twist, Granny Apple Green, and Coastal Cabana. Before I die cut these pieces, I used a Water Painter to splatter water droplets, and dried the cardstock with a Heat Tool. I then used a Water Painter, along with White Craft Ink to add some splatters. Layered underneath the flowers and leaves, is a die cut created with Basic White Cardstock, using one of the Thoughtful Wishes Dies.

The sentiment (from the Layers of Beauty Stamp Set) was heat-embossed on Basic Black Cardstock, using my Versamark Pad and White Embossing Powder. For a bit of bling, I sprinkled on embellishments from the Blooming Pearls and Iridescent Faceted Gems.
